php是啥,PHP:的编程语言
PHP是一种开源的、通用的脚本语言,特别适用于Web开发。它可以嵌入HTML中,也可以被编译成命令行执行。PHP语言简单易学,功能强大,是众多开发者的编程语言。下面我们来详细了解一下PHP的特点和优势。
一、PHP的特点
1.易学易用
PHP语言的语法非常简单,与C语言和Perl语言类似,因此易于学习和使用。即使没有编程经验,也可以很快上手。
2.开源免费
PHP是开源的,任何人都可以免费使用、修改和分发。这使得PHP成为一个非常受欢迎的编程语言。
3.跨平台
PHP可以在多种操作系统上运行,包括Windows、Linux、Unix等。这使得PHP成为一个非常灵活的编程语言,可以在不同的平台上开发和运行Web应用程序。
4.支持多种数据库
PHP支持多个主流的数据库,包括MySQL、Oracle、PostgreSQL等。这使得PHP成为一个非常适合Web开发的编程语言。
二、PHP的优势
1.速度快
PHP的解释器非常快,可以在短时间内处理大量的请求。这使得PHP成为一个非常适合Web开发的编程语言。
2.灵活性强
PHP可以与多种Web服务器和数据库配合使用,可以轻松地创建和管理Web应用程序。这使得PHP成为一个非常灵活的编程语言。
3.安全性高
PHP具有很高的安全性,可以有效地防止SQL注入等攻击。这使得PHP成为一个非常适合Web开发的编程语言。
4.可扩展性强
PHP具有很强的可扩展性,可以通过插件或扩展库来扩展其功能。这使得PHP成为一个非常适合Web开发的编程语言。
5.社区活跃
PHP拥有一个庞大的开发者社区,可以在社区中获取到各种技术支持和帮助。这使得PHP成为一个非常受欢迎的编程语言。
小标题1:PHP的应用领域
PHP可以应用于多个领域,包括Web开发、桌面应用程序、命令行脚本等。在Web开发领域,PHP被广泛应用于开发动态网站、电子商务网站、社交网络等。
小标题2:PHP的基本语法
PHP的基本语法包括变量、常量、运算符、控制结构、函数、数组等。了解这些基本语法对于学习和使用PHP非常重要。
小标题3:PHP的面向对象编程
PHP支持面向对象编程,可以使用类、对象、继承、多态等面向对象编程的特性。面向对象编程可以使PHP代码更加清晰、可维护和可扩展。
小标题4:PHP的框架
PHP有多个流行的框架,包括Laravel、Symfony、CodeIgniter等。这些框架可以帮助开发者更快地开发Web应用程序,并提供了许多有用的功能和特性。
小标题5:PHP的安全性
PHP具有很高的安全性,可以通过各种方式来保护Web应用程序的安全。这包括使用过滤器、加密数据、防止SQL注入等。
小标题6:PHP的优化
PHP可以通过多种方式进行优化,包括使用缓存、减少数据库查询、使用CDN等。这些优化可以使Web应用程序更快地响应用户请求,提高用户体验。
PHP是一种非常强大和灵活的编程语言,可以应用于多个领域。学习和掌握PHP对于开发者来说非常重要,可以帮助他们更快地开发Web应用程序,并提高他们的职业竞争力。